How does a train work? A question which, in a safe mode, can only arrive after another: How does it slow down a train? Pneumatic braking, electric braking, sole, pad ... all this in a simplified version to help you understand the world of the train a little better. From complicated not complicated (in my way what): How does train braking work, pneumatic braking, rheostatic braking, train brake distributor, train emergency braking, alarm signal ... 00:00 Intro 00:18 Brake before moving forward 03:24 Continuous automatic brake 06:23 The electric brake 07:20 The magnetic brake 07:56 The alarm signal 09:49 Brake tests My twitter: / philippe_peray
